History of Franklin & Pickaway Counties, Ohio. Williams Bros. 1880------------------------------------------------------
 Isaac Case came from Simsbury, Connecticut to Worthington, in 1804 with his family, consisting of wife and fivechildren. Two more were born after settlement. He bought a farm of ninety-fiveacres, west of the river, but lived in the town, where he built a cabin, goingfrom thence to his farm while engaged in clearing the land. He remained in thevillage a year or two, and then erected a cabin on this land, with no chimney,but simple a hile in the roof, through which the smoke could escape. They soonhad a puncheon floor and chimney. His children were: Orlando, who married anddied on the farm; Melona, who died with consumption; Pyrene, who was twice married and died in Kentucky -- her first husband was a tanner and currier, and hadcharge of that department in the Worthington factory; Philo, who died in Indiana, leaving a small family of children; Isaac Newton, who married Emily Vining,by who he had two children -- she died, and he married Mrs. Julia Case, by whohe has one child -- and Hane, who married and died in Union county.
